The Traditional Ruler of Enugu Na Mkpokoro Achi, in Oji River Local Government Area, Igwe Chima Achiekwelu, (Eze Ishiala) Saturday, 10th of October, 2020 hosted the annual New Yam Festival.
The age-long New Yam Festival which usually celebrates the successful farming and harvest season in the old Achi Clan is traditionally known as Nneche Ji.
In his address at the occasion Igwe Achiekwelu thanked the God for the great agricultural yield witnessed in his community and commended his subjects for investing in Agriculture which according to him is key to fighting poverty in the rural communities.
The Traditional Ruler also commended the Enugu State Governor, Honourable Ifeanyi Ugwuanyi for providing a peaceful environment which has guaranteed true growth and development in the State.
This year’s festival which was well attended by Achi sons and daughters from within and outside the country was spiced with a wrestling and boxing match as well as performances by various cultural troupes.
Prizes won by winners include tricycles, motorcycles, refrigerators, generators and other cash prizes which many described as fitting incentives for promoting the culture of the people.
Speaking at the event, the Chairman of Oji River Local Government Area who promised government support for the festival, commended Igwe Achiekwelu for his unrelenting effort in promoting and preserving the Achi culture and tradition which well harnessed has the capacity to boost tourism and the well-being of the rural communities.
Government officials, traditional rulers and notable sons and daughters of Achi attended this year’s New Yam Festival which witnessed a large crowd of cultural enthusiasts.
